Dutch influencer arrested for walking around naked on Greek island
Dutch influencer Samuel Onuha (26), the founder of the clothing brand ICON.Amsterdam, was arrested on the Greek island of Mykonos for public nudity. His brother Ruben Onuha confirmed the arrest on Instagram, saying his brother may have suffered a psychotic episode.
Images are circulating online showing Onuha walking naked in a square on the Greek island. According to Greek media, he also slapped and pushed his genitals against a statue of former Prime Minister Konstantinos Karamanlis.
Brother Ruben (24) confirmed on Instagram that the footage was of his brother. According to him, Samuel had a psychotic episode before wandering off naked. “It came completely unexpectedly, and we still do not fully understand how or why it happened,” he wrote. “He was not himself, which led to the behavior seen in those videos.” Ruben added that Samuel is safe and recovering.
The Ministry of Foreign Affairs told RTL Nieuws that it had not yet received a request for consular assistance. According to the broadcaster, the local authorities are investigating whether Onuha was under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
